30/7/2011 11:22 | I am beginning to come round on this. Point being have had a brief cast over the figures from last half yearly report. Gross margin 12 months to 30/09/10 was 53.03% 6 months to March 10 51.3% 6months to March 11 50.55% A gross margin of over 50% is pretty impressive and illustartes that if teh company can scale up sales every addition £1 in sales gives 0ver 50p in gross profit. The important issue is to enusre operating costs are kept under control Operaing costs as a percentage of turn over: 12 months to 30/09/10 55.35% 6 months to March 10 54.18% 6months to March 11 46.25% In the 12 months to 30/9/11 if operating costs can be improved upon from the 46.25% and at worst kept under the 50% things begin to look more and more interesting. We may be some time off the company gaining critical mass but the hacking and computer security is not going to go away over night. What the figures will be in September will be very telling. It may be that strategy has chnaged and rather than focusing on the big contract wins that carry obvious risk of not getting them. Gaining lots of smaller contracts first may be what the company is doing. | berny3 | |
